[QUOTE="Spragleknas, post: 561850, member: 17435"] I think a new MediaPortal 1.1 "Get-you-going"-guide would be nice, as much has changed. For the moment, I think daMaster's guide is the best to get you going w/1.1 -> [url]https://forum.team-mediaportal.com/newcomers-forum-240/mediaportal-install-guide-49685/[/url] Codec setup has changed somewhat and is dependent on OS (Win7 is even less hassle due to good MS-DTV codecs). In general, a clean install of MP w/Win7: - MP 1.1 RC1 or newer (coming soon...) - Haali mediaSPlitter - StreamedMP w/MovingPictures + MP TV-series - Online Vids (YouTube) - Additional plugins and skins That is about it. :thx: for your kind (and motivational) words!
